Wonderland

2003 | Crime, Drama, Mystery, Thriller, Actual Events Adaptation

Synopsis

The true story of legendary porn star John Holmes' involvement in the 1981 Wonderland Avenue murders in Los Angeles.

Critic Consensus

35.7% Fresh • 98 critic reviews

Critic reception is largely negative, with 36% of 98 logged reviews marked Fresh. Across reviews, critics repeatedly emphasize thin plot, stylized, suspenseful. Many reviews cite pacing issues, thin plot as the main reasons it falls short.
